Maritime Fuel Cell Systems in Germany’s Hydrogen Market

Germany's National Hydrogen Strategy positions the country as a global leader in hydrogen technology. With EUR 9 billion allocated to hydrogen infrastructure, German electrolyser OEMs and project developers are scaling rapidly. The industrial heartland of North Rhine-Westphalia, combined with hydrogen hubs in Hamburg and Bavaria, creates sustained demand for high-performance AWE membranes that can reduce production costs.

Is IONZERA a viable Zirfon alternative for German electrolyser OEMs?

Yes. IONZERA provides 3x lower area resistance (0.09-0.1 vs 0.30 ohm-cm2) and a 20% thinner profile compared to Zirfon PERL UTP 500. It is a drop-in replacement compatible with standard AWE operating conditions, offering German OEMs both performance improvement and supply chain diversification.
